Output 29559022be6ed266c8cc3d486629af8d0bb7522304f6c086c34fedeb0c8ae9b6:0

value
856599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b6e90edd036415ef9593b01257891357a1c4240 OP_EQUAL
address
3EQGJUeWzh2chSjvmPrEDxHZGMEg6jYgEB
transaction
29559022be6ed266c8cc3d486629af8d0bb7522304f6c086c34fedeb0c8ae9b6